Factors Affecting fire shutter cost

Several factors can influence the cost of fire shutters, including:

1. Size of the Shutters: The size of the fire shutters you need will have a significant impact on the cost. Larger shutters will generally cost more than smaller ones.

2. Material: Fire shutters are typically made from steel or aluminum, with steel shutters being more expensive than aluminum ones.

3. Fire Rating: The fire rating of the shutters will also affect the cost. Higher-rated shutters that can withstand fires for longer periods will be more expensive.

4. Installation: The cost of installing fire shutters will depend on the complexity of the installation and whether any additional structural work is required.

5. Additional Features: Some fire shutters come with additional features such as smoke detectors or battery backups, which can increase the cost.

Average Cost of Fire Shutters

On average, the cost of fire shutters can range from $1,000 to $5,000 per shutter. This cost includes the materials, installation, and any additional features. Keep in mind that this is just an average estimate, and the actual cost could be higher or lower depending on the factors mentioned above.

Benefits of Installing Fire Shutters

While the cost of fire shutters may seem high, the benefits of installing them far outweigh the expense. Some of the key benefits of fire shutters include:

1. Fire Protection: Fire shutters help contain fires and prevent them from spreading throughout a building, reducing the risk of damage and injury.

2. Compliance: Installing fire shutters can help you comply with building codes and regulations, ensuring the safety of your building and its occupants.

3. Insurance Savings: Some insurance companies offer discounts to buildings that have fire protection measures in place, such as fire shutters.

4. Peace of Mind: Knowing that your building is equipped with fire shutters can give you peace of mind and confidence in the safety of your property.
